Side-by-Side Comparison

Feature active alive
Definition Having the power or quality of acting; causing change; communicating action or motion; acting;—opposed to passive, that receives. Having life; living; not dead.

Why the eye confuses active with alive

A purely visual mix-up. active (/ˈæk.tɪv/) and alive (/əˈlaɪv/) are said differently, so reading them aloud is the quickest way to catch the wrong one. On the page they stay close: they differ by 1 letter(s) in length. Our composite confusion score for this pair is 3019, derived from the frequency rank of both members and their visual similarity.

active is recorded at frequency rank #1,239, classified as anadj, pronounced /ˈæk.tɪv/. alive is at rank #1,780, tagged as anadj, pronounced /əˈlaɪv/.
